Weisskirchen Mouse Pipe – imitate a mouse in distress to lure in foxes
Put the mouse pipe under your upper lip and aspirate a quick succession of the mouse’s excited squeaks into it.
Foxes will hear these sounds at a distance of more than 400m. They will be lured in to see what is going on in the area.
Remember a mouse doesn’t whistle, it chirps quietly and in an excited way. With this easy to use whistle, it should be simple to replicate the sounds needed.
